LGALS1 (galectin-1) is a beta-galactoside-binding lectin that regulates apoptosis, cell proliferation and differentiation. It can modulate CD45 phosphatase activity and T-cell responses.
LGALS1 is studied in carbohydrate-dependent cell signalling, immune-cell regulation, apoptosis, differentiation and inflammatory responses.
